Subject: Order-cutoff fix is live

Hey on-call folks — quick heads up. The Crumbletop order-cutoff rule now correctly uses the bakery's local timezone instead of server time, so the 2pm cutoff for next-day pastry orders actually means 2pm. If anyone reports orders being rejected early, it's probably stale cache, not the rule. The fix shipped in the build noted below.

build token for kagaf-hahof: htk14_9d3d4d26d7d8de

CI note for support: the Pantrywise recipe-scaling calculator's test job intermittently fails on the fraction-rounding suite. The cause is a flaky fixture that seeds random ingredient quantities without pinning the seed, so thirds and fifths occasionally round differently across runs. A rerun usually passes, but that masks real regressions — please do not advise customers that scaling output varies by design. If a ticket references failing scaling math, ask for the build token printed at the top of their CI log, reproduced below.

pipeline stamp: htk3_69f

## Configuration — Squeal Lint

Squeal lints all .sql files under migrations/ and queries/. Rules live in .squealrc; the weekly sync agreed to enforce uppercase keywords, no SELECT *, and mandatory table aliases. CI fails on any error-level finding. Runtime options come from lint.env: SQUEAL_RULESET=strict and SQUEAL_MAX_WARNINGS=0. The lint report uploader also needs its publish credential, which belongs on the next line of that file.

env line for fafof-fahag: LEDGER_TOKEN5=f8790